When is Easter 2024?
Easter holiday is among the most important Christian festivals that commemorate the resurrection of Jesus Christ. According to the Bible, the Christian Holy book, Jesus resurrected on the third day after being crucified on Friday. Although the population of Christians in India is only 2.5%, the observance is marked countrywide even by the non-Christians.
What is Easter?
Jesus died and was crucified on Good Friday. He spent three days buried in the tomb, but on the third day, he is believed to have risen. A woman by the name Mary Magdalene found the tomb empty on Sunday, and Jesus is believed to have resurrected. The celebrations start 40 days before Easter, a period called the lent season to signify the time Jesus was in the wilderness in preparation for his death. The Easter season also encompasses Palm Sunday, the day he rode on a donkey into the city of Jerusalem and Maundy Thursday, which was the day he had the last supper with his disciples before his crucifixion.

Is Easter a public holiday?
Easter holiday is a restricted holiday in India. Since Easter falls on Sunday, it, therefore, remains a day off to most people. Unlike in many countries where Easter Sunday’s observance is moved to Monday, this does not happen in India.
What is open or closed on Easter?
Indians have a day off on Sunday, and therefore government offices, banks, post offices remain closed on Easter Sunday. Some businesses many, however, operate per the Sunday working hours. Public transport may also be slightly affected due to heavy traffic in areas with a high Christian population.
Things to do on Easter
Easter is the second-largest Christian festival after Christmas. The majority of Christians are situated in the states of Goa, Kerala, Tamil Nadu, Nagaland, and Manipur.
As a Christian, start this day by heading to church for special service and prayers. At the church, you can take part in candle lighting, flower decorations, dancing, and ringing the church bell.
In Nagaland, you can join thousands of Christians at the World War II cemetery for the popular Easter sunrise service. The service is welcome to all and involves various church denominations coming together to worship.
Similarly, if you are in Goa, you will have the opportunity to participate in special masses and attend the famous Goa carnival. The festival is marked with street dramas, dancing, singing, and cultural costume. The best part is that plenty of flowers and Easter lanterns are given to those who participate in the various activities. If you stay in Kerala, your best bet would be to attend the midnight services at St Joseph’s cathedral catholic church.
You can also organize a feast at home that features traditional cuisines. It is common to serve lamb for dinner since it is believed that Jesus is a symbol of sacrifice. Moreover, a lamb is tender and flavourful to serve as an excellent meal for dinner.
Children get new clothes, decorate eggs, and participate in egg hunt activities believed to have been hidden by the Easter Bunny. On top of that, the children receive gift baskets full of candy, snacks, among other presents.
